This upholstery fabric caught my eye, it was quite far from my personal aesthetic so I had to rise to the challenge... which was rather simple since I had been looking for some time already for a fabric that would beg to be showcased by this pattern.

I was drawn to its clean lines, practical yet unobtrusive volume, practical storage... and the opportunity to highlight a large “panel”.

A roll end of black faux leather, a taupe faux leather test scrap entrusted by my favorite hardware supplier, remnants of linen canvas, two new zippers, one upcycled... all complemented by light gold metal hardware.

What do you do with your production offcuts?

Your own bespoke fabric offcuts aren't covered here: they're always sent back to you with your finished piece, unless you tell me to keep them or dispose of them differently.

As for my own production offcuts: nothing is thrown away if I can help it. They're reused in my workshop for reinforcement, worked into mosaics to create larger pieces, or used as is for small creations (keychains, bookmarks...). The rest is given away depending on its nature and size: to other artisans (such as jewellery makers), or to associations, community centres and schools for their workshops.
